Neuware - Shakespeare's Ovid: Being Arthur Golding's Translation of The Metamorphoses (1904) is a book that contains the complete translation of The Metamorphoses, a famous work by the Roman poet Ovid, as translated by Arthur Golding. The Metamorphoses is a collection of myths and legends from ancient Greece and Rome, and it has been a source of inspiration for many writers throughout history, including Shakespeare. In this book, readers can explore the stories of gods, heroes, and mortals, and witness their transformations and adventures. Golding's translation is considered to be one of the most influential and important translations of The Metamorphoses, and it has been praised for its accuracy and poetic quality. This edition also includes an introduction by J. W. Mackail, which provides context and background information about the book and its significance.
